Pyschologists and mental health experts said on Sunday that mental illness is curable, but there is a lack of understanding of it among Cambodians, causing them not to consult with experts.
The issue was raised at the Project Inspire Conference 2019 – under the theme of Mental Health and Wellbeing – held on Sunday at the Cambodia-Korea Cooperation Centre at the Royal University of Phnom Penh.
The gathering aims to inspire action regarding the emotional and mental wellbeing of youth in contemporary society.
